My little lexicon was a 41-title series of children's books from Kinderbuchverlag Berlin for readers aged 9 and over. Each of them dealt with lexically in detail only a certain subject area.

The 16.5 cm × 24 cm books had a hard cardboard cover and cost 5.80  marks . When the last title in the Ginger, Rice and Mahogany series was published in 1990, the format was reduced to 15 cm × 22 cm and a glossy surface was chosen for the cover.
